Vijayawada

   Also found in: Dictionary/thesaurus, Wikipedia, Hutchinson 0.23 sec.
Vijayawada (vĭjä'yəväd`ə), formerly Bezwada, city (1991 pop. 845,756), Andhra Pradesh state, SE India, near the Krishna River delta. It is a transportation and administrative hub and the trade center for the Eastern Ghats. It has an airport with connections to major Indian cities. Chromite is mined in the vicinity and toys are manufactured. Vijayawada is a religious center and destination for Hindi pilgrims; Brahmanic cave temples (7th-century Dravidian) are nearby.
Vijayawada
a town in SE India, in E central Andra Pradesh on the Krishna River: Hindu pilgrimage centre. Pop.: 825 436 (2001)
